What Is Magnesium Glycinate with Zinc?
Magnesium glycinate with zinc is a dietary supplement combining magnesium—bound to glycine, an amino acid—and elemental zinc. This compound form is prized because it increases absorption efficiency and reduces gastrointestinal discomfort often caused by other magnesium salts like oxide or citrate. Simply put, it’s magnesium and zinc delivered in a way that your body can actually use effectively.

Key Factors of Magnesium Glycinate with Zinc
- Bioavailability: Magnesium glycinate is known for its superior absorption, often outperforming other forms. Zinc also benefits from this chelated form, promoting better uptake.
- Gastrointestinal Tolerance: Unlike magnesium oxide, glycinate is gentle on the stomach, making it suitable for long-term supplementation.
- Synergistic Effects: Zinc and magnesium work together in over 300 enzymatic reactions, supporting everything from muscle recovery to cognitive health.
- Dosage Flexibility: Products can be tailored to deliver balanced amounts, accommodating different age groups and health needs.
- Purity & Quality: Premium formulations minimize additives and contaminants — crucial in clinical or sensitive-use scenarios.

FAQ: Frequently Asked Questions About Magnesium Glycinate with Zinc
- Is magnesium glycinate with zinc better than other magnesium forms for absorption?
- Yes, the glycinate chelated form is generally better absorbed and gentler on the stomach than oxide or citrate forms. Zinc in this combo also benefits from improved uptake.
- Can I take magnesium glycinate with zinc daily without side effects?
- For most people, daily consumption within recommended dosages is safe and well-tolerated. However, excessive intake may cause mild digestive upset, so follow label instructions or consult a healthcare professional.
- Who should consider magnesium glycinate with zinc supplements?
- Individuals with mineral deficiencies, athletes needing muscle support, older adults, or those with impaired absorption conditions benefit most from these supplements.
- How does magnesium glycinate with zinc impact immune health?
- Both minerals are essential for immune system function. Zinc plays a direct antiviral and antibacterial role, while magnesium supports cellular energy and inflammatory regulation.
